Mexico City in February
February warms up without rain, and the jacaranda trees start turning the southern neighbourhoods purple towards the end of the month.
Is February a good time to visit Mexico City?
February is one of the better months to visit Mexico City. Crowds sit around 54/100, with typical highs near 24°C.

How crowded is Mexico City in February?
Mexico City sits at roughly 54/100 in February on our crowd scale, which is 7 points below the yearly average. The quietest month is January.
What is the weather like in Mexico City in February?
Expect highs around 24°C and lows near 8°C in February, with about 2 wet days across the month.
